Bharat Sanchar Nigam Limited (BSNL) announced, a new plan for its existing customers in view to counter the rising competition from MTNL (which introduced a new up-gradation plan for its existing customers), Airtel and others who have a stronghold in this segment. BSNL has announced that they will provide double speed at same price at no extra cost, for its existing customers from April 1st, 2010 to April 30th, 2010.
Plan details are listed below
Existing Plan Name | Revised Plan Name * | Existing Bandwidth Speed | Revised Bandwidth speed |
BB Home Combo UL 625 CS1 | BB Home Combo UL 625 CS1 | 256 Kbps | 512 Kbps |
Home UL 750 | BB Home UL 750 | 256 Kbps | 512 Kbps |
BB Home Combo ULF 900 | BB Home Combo ULF 900 | 512 Kbps upto 8 GB, 256 Kbps beyond 8 GB | 1 Mbps upto 8 GB, 256 Kbps beyond 8 GB |
BB Home Combo ULF 1000 | BB Home Combo ULF 1000 | 1 Mbps upto 9 GB, 256 Kbps beyond 9 GB | 2 Mbps upto 9 GB, 256 Kbps beyond 9 GB |
Home UL 1350 Plus | BB Home Combo UL 1350 | 512 Kbps | 1 Mbps |
VAS Home Combo ULF 1499 | BB Home Combo ULF 1499 | 1 Mbps upto 25 GB, 256 Kbps beyond 25 GB | 2 Mbps upto 25 GB, 256 Kbps beyond 25 GB |
BB Home Rural USOF Combo UL 500 | BB Home Rural USOF Combo UL 500 | 512 Kbps upto 4 GB, 256 Kbps beyond 4 GB | 1 Mbps upto 4 GB, 256 Kbps beyond 4 GB |
Rural USO Home UL 799 | BB Home Rural USOF UL 799 | 512 Kbps | 1 Mbps |
Rural USO HomeCombo UL 899 | BB Home Rural USOF Combo UL 899 | 512 Kbps | 1 Mbps |
The plan has been introduced to counter the popularity of MTNL’s offer (which has been spiraling ever since it was introduced) which provides the same offer, that is, double speed at same price with no extra cost, for its existing customers. The offer is valid only for 30 days commencing April 1st, 2010.
